Elon Musk's net worth has fallen back below $1 trillion, less than two weeks after briefly becoming the world's first trillionaire, amid a significant decline in SpaceX shares. The move is headline-grabbing but appears driven by valuation pressure in a private company rather than a broad market event. Market impact is likely limited outside of sentiment around Musk-linked assets.
